Documentation
¶
Index ¶
- type DBTX
- type InsertLogParams
- type InsertSpanParams
- type Log
- type Metric
- type Queries
- func (q *Queries) InsertLog(ctx context.Context, arg InsertLogParams) (int64, error)
- func (q *Queries) InsertMetric(ctx context.Context, data []byte) (int64, error)
- func (q *Queries) InsertSpan(ctx context.Context, arg InsertSpanParams) (int64, error)
- func (q *Queries) SelectLogsSince(ctx context.Context, arg SelectLogsSinceParams) ([]Log, error)
- func (q *Queries) SelectMetricsSince(ctx context.Context, arg SelectMetricsSinceParams) ([]Metric, error)
- func (q *Queries) SelectSpansSince(ctx context.Context, arg SelectSpansSinceParams) ([]Span, error)
- func (q *Queries) WithTx(tx *sql.Tx) *Queries
- type SelectLogsSinceParams
- type SelectMetricsSinceParams
- type SelectSpansSinceParams
- type Span
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type InsertLogParams ¶
type InsertSpanParams ¶
type InsertSpanParams struct {
TraceID string
SpanID string
TraceState string
ParentSpanID sql.NullString
Flags int64
Name string
Kind string
StartTime int64
EndTime sql.NullInt64
Attributes []byte
DroppedAttributesCount int64
Events []byte
DroppedEventsCount int64
Links []byte
DroppedLinksCount int64
StatusCode int64
StatusMessage string
InstrumentationScope []byte
Resource []byte
ResourceSchemaUrl string
}
type Queries ¶
type Queries struct {
// contains filtered or unexported fields
}
func (*Queries) InsertMetric ¶
func (*Queries) InsertSpan ¶
func (*Queries) SelectLogsSince ¶
func (*Queries) SelectMetricsSince ¶
func (*Queries) SelectSpansSince ¶
type SelectLogsSinceParams ¶
type SelectSpansSinceParams ¶
type Span ¶
type Span struct {
ID int64
TraceID string
SpanID string
TraceState string
ParentSpanID sql.NullString
Flags int64
Name string
Kind string
StartTime int64
EndTime sql.NullInt64
Attributes []byte
DroppedAttributesCount int64
Events []byte
DroppedEventsCount int64
Links []byte
DroppedLinksCount int64
StatusCode int64
StatusMessage string
InstrumentationScope []byte
Resource []byte
ResourceSchemaUrl string
}
Click to show internal directories.
Click to hide internal directories.